CONNECTING THE ATTACHMENTS
Always be sure the appliance is unplugged before connecting or removing any
attachments.
Blending & Whisk Attachments
• Toattachtheblendingorwhiskattachment,insert
the attachment so the UNLOCK
symbol on the
attachment is lined up to the dash on the motor
body.
• Turntheattachmentuntilthetwopiecesarelined
up in the LOCK
position (B).
• Toremovetheattachment,twistuntiltheUNLOCK
symbol on the attachment is lined up with the
dash on the motor body. Pull the pieces apart.

SELECTING A SPEED
1. Select a speed – from 1 to 5 – using the speed
control dial on the top of the motor body (E).
Note: The speed can be changed at any time whether
the appliance is turned on or off.
2. Press the POWER
button to turn the blender ON
at the selected speed. The blender turns OFF when
the button is released (F).
Note: To pulse, press and release the POWER
button at 5-second intervals.
3. For an extra burst of power while blending, there
is a POWER BOOST button just below the Power
button. This feature allows the appliance to
increase speed and maneuver through thicker
mixtures. The appliance will turn OFF when this
button is released (G).
USING THE ATTACHMENTS
Using the Blending Attachment
This attachment is used for blending a variety of foods, including soups, sauces,
salad dressings and powdered drinks into a smooth mixture without lumps
directly in the sauce pan, measuring cup, beaker or bowl. This appliance mixes,
blends, purees and stirs while adding very little air to the mixture.
